What is the top part of a steeple?

The top part of a steeple is typically called the "spire." It is a pointed structure that rises from the roof of a building, often a church, and is designed to draw the eye upward, symbolizing aspiration and reaching towards the heavens. Spires can be adorned with various decorative elements, such as weather vanes or crosses, and they vary in height and design depending on architectural style.
